House raising services involve elevating a structure to a higher foundation level, often to protect it from flood damage or to facilitate foundation repairs. The process typically includes carefully lifting the entire building using specialized equipment, then placing it on new or modified supports. This service requires precise planning and execution to ensure the stability and integrity of the property during and after the lift. It is often performed on homes that are experiencing issues related to rising water levels or those needing foundation upgrades.
Raising a house can help address a variety of problems, particularly flooding and water damage. Properties located in flood-prone areas or near bodies of water are common candidates for house raising. By elevating the structure, homeowners can reduce the risk of flood damage, which can lead to costly repairs and structural deterioration over time. Additionally, house raising can be part of broader renovation or repair efforts, such as fixing settling foundations or updating aging structures to meet current safety standards.
This service is frequently utilized for residential properties, especially single-family homes, but it can also be applicable to multi-family dwellings and commercial buildings in certain circumstances. Older homes that were built before modern floodplain regulations are often candidates for house raising. In areas where new flood zone maps are implemented, property owners may opt for raising services to comply with updated regulations or to protect their investments from future water-related risks.

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$10,000 and $50,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, raising a small single-story home may be closer to $10,000, while larger or more intricate structures can reach higher costs.
Factors Affecting Cost - Expenses can vary based on the home's foundation type, height, and accessibility. Additional work such as foundation repairs or upgrades can increase the overall price, with some projects exceeding $60,000 in certain cases.
Average Expenses - On average, homeowners in Belmond, IA, might expect to pay around $20,000 to $35,000 for house raising services. These figures serve as general estimates and can fluctuate based on specific project requirements.
Cost Considerations - Costs often include labor, equipment, and materials, but may not cover permits or additional structural work. Contact local service providers to get detailed quotes tailored to individual house raising needs.
